后颅窝:基于MRI对印度南部同质人群线性尺寸和容积的比较解剖学研究

The posterior cranial fossa: a comparative MRI-based anatomic study of linear dimensions and volumetry in a homogeneous South Indian population.

作者信息

Chadha Awalpreet Singh, Madhugiri Venkatesh S, Tejus M N, Kumar V R Roopesh

机构信息

Department of Neurosurgery, Jawaharlal Institute of Postgraduate Medical Education and Research (JIPMER), Pondicherry, 605006, India.

出版信息

Surg Radiol Anat. 2015 Oct;37(8):901-12. doi: 10.1007/s00276-015-1434-7. Epub 2015 Jan 28.

DOI:10.1007/s00276-015-1434-7
PMID:25626883
Abstract

PURPOSE

The posterior fossa contains structures that are vital to life. In this study, we aimed at establishing normal linear dimensions and volume data of the posterior fossa in a homogeneous south Indian population. We also evaluated the influence of large tumors on these parameters. We evaluated the accuracy of different techniques of measuring these dimensions and compared them with literature.

MATERIALS AND METHODS

Control and tumor MRIs were selected from an imaging database. Linear posterior fossa dimensions as well as volumes were measured using Image J and Fiji. The volume data were compared with similar data from literature. The effect of the presence of a tumor on posterior fossa volume was measured.

RESULTS

The posterior fossa volume was higher in men than in women, irrespective of whether the volume was estimated on axial, sagittal or coronal MR images. Despite the wide variation in the techniques used, there was no significant difference between the volumes reported in literature and the volumes calculated in the current series. The presence of large tumors did not affect linear dimensions or posterior fossa volumes. Among the techniques based on linear measurements that were assessed for concordance with manual segmentation, the technique using the formula for volume of an ellipsoid had the best agreement.

CONCLUSIONS

Posterior fossa volume is higher in men than in women, Posterior fossa dimensions were not affected by the presence of large tumors. Manual segmentation remains the most accurate method to measure posterior fossa volume.

摘要

目的

后颅窝包含对生命至关重要的结构。在本研究中,我们旨在确定印度南部同质人群后颅窝的正常线性尺寸和体积数据。我们还评估了大型肿瘤对这些参数的影响。我们评估了测量这些尺寸的不同技术的准确性,并与文献进行了比较。

材料与方法

从影像数据库中选取对照和肿瘤的磁共振成像(MRI)。使用Image J和Fiji测量后颅窝的线性尺寸以及体积。将体积数据与文献中的类似数据进行比较。测量肿瘤的存在对后颅窝体积的影响。

结果

无论在轴向、矢状或冠状MRI图像上估计体积,男性的后颅窝体积均高于女性。尽管所使用的技术差异很大,但文献报道的体积与本系列计算的体积之间没有显著差异。大型肿瘤的存在并未影响线性尺寸或后颅窝体积。在基于线性测量且评估与手动分割一致性的技术中,使用椭球体体积公式的技术一致性最佳。

结论

男性的后颅窝体积高于女性,大型肿瘤的存在不影响后颅窝尺寸。手动分割仍然是测量后颅窝体积最准确的方法。
